摘要:
高并发解决方案 之限流-基础 高并发之扩容思路 高并发之缓存 缓存并发问题--枷锁 缓存穿透问题 如何避免缓存穿透 1.缓存空对象,对查询结果为空的对象也进行缓存,如果是集合可以缓存一个空集合但不是null,如果是缓存单个对象可以通过字段标识来区分, 这样避免请求穿透到后端数据库,同时也需要保存缓存 阅读全文
摘要:
高并发解决方案 之限流-基础 高并发之扩容思路 高并发之缓存 缓存并发问题--枷锁 缓存穿透问题 如何避免缓存穿透 1.缓存空对象,对查询结果为空的对象也进行缓存,如果是集合可以缓存一个空集合但不是null,如果是缓存单个对象可以通过字段标识来区分, 这样避免请求穿透到后端数据库,同时也需要保存缓存 阅读全文